An impact-driven tutoring organization is seeking SEND Tutors and Teachers to make a difference in the lives of young people with Special Educational Needs in the UK. You will provide in-person, remote, or hybrid lessons for subjects like Math, English, and Science.
The role requires a qualified teacher with experience in working with SEND students. Flexible working hours and competitive pay ($28-35/hour) are offered, along with comprehensive support and professional development opportunities.

How to prepare for a job interview at TARGETED PROVISION LTD
✨Know Your SEND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of Special Educational Needs. Familiarise yourself with different types of SEND and effective teaching strategies. This will show the interviewers that you're not just qualified, but genuinely passionate about making a difference.
✨Showcase Your Flexibility
Since this role offers flexible working hours, be prepared to discuss how you can adapt your teaching methods to fit various schedules and learning environments. Share examples from your past experiences where you've successfully tailored your approach to meet students' needs.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ect questions that ask how you would handle specific situations with SEND students. Think of real-life scenarios you've encountered and how you resolved them. This will demonstrate your problem-solving skills and ability to think on your feet.
✨Highlight Your Commitment to Development
The organisation values professional development, so be ready to talk about any training or courses you've undertaken related to SEND. Discuss your eagerness to continue learning and how you plan to stay updated with best practices in the field.
